Immerse yourself in the captivating world of Grażyna Bacewicz, a prominent figure in neoclassical music, with her 2018 album "Bacewicz: Two Piano Quintets, Quartet for Four Violins & Quartet for Four Cellos." This album is a testament to Bacewicz's mastery of chamber music, showcasing her unique compositions that blend technical prowess with emotional depth.
The album features four distinct works, each offering a unique listening experience. The two piano quintets, along with the quartet for four violins and the quartet for four cellos, demonstrate Bacewicz's versatility and innovative approach to composition. The quartet formations are particularly unusual, adding an element of intrigue and freshness to the collection.
Each piece is meticulously crafted, with Bacewicz's signature dramatic and lyrical writing style evident throughout. The piano quintets, in particular, are notable for their expressive depth and technical complexity. The quartet for four violins and the quartet for four cellos, on the other hand, offer a more intimate and reflective listening experience.
The album spans a total duration of 1 hour and 3 minutes, providing a comprehensive exploration of Bacewicz's musical genius.
